Liverpool have tabled a bid for Atletico Madrid striker Diego Costa. Punto Pelota says Arsenal are also keen on the Brazilian, but it is only Liverpool which have so far made a firm offer for the striker. Atletico directors met yesterday to discuss the offer and whether they could afford to lose Diego Costa after selling his former strike-partner Radamel Falcao to AS Monaco last month. Diego Costa is aware of the Reds offer and keen to speak with the Premier League giants - with Atletico's approval.

Liverpool's 19-year-old defender Jack Robinson joins Championship side Blackpool on a season-long loan. England Under-21 international Robinson is set to make his debut in Saturday's opening game of the season at Doncaster Rovers. As part of the agreement, Liverpool will retain the option to recall the player after 28 days. Robinson has made nine senior starts for Liverpool.
